Title :
Identification and improvement of design issues of a sales management system for VOIP wholesaler

Abstract :
VOIP (Voice over IP Protocol) is an emerging field including a lot of wholesale companies in market striving to give cost effective wholesale VoIP termination and business VoIP services to its clients. The VOIP wholesaler processes bulk of calls per day therefore, have to manage a large amount of data i.e. calls, clients, contracts and its account managers. Sales Management Systems are used to manage such records. This research focuses on one of such systems i.e. a sales management system for VOIP wholesaler. The system is deployed by a software house in Islamabad, Pakistan to a VOIP wholesaler to manage his business. The end user of the system faced difficulties while using the system. The system has different design issues. The purpose of this research is the identification and correction of these design issues to improve usability and user´s experience. The design issues are highlighted after interviewing client, project manager and general issues which are not in accordance with HCI´s (Human Computer Interaction) principles. The design issues are related to the interface of the system its color scheme and information display. The objective is to provide the most relevant and important information to the client on minimum clicks.
